Specialized Drug Preparations Tailored to Individual Patients
When traditional pharmacy solutions fail to meet specific needs, compound pharmacies step in. These unique facilities offer a wide range of medications customized for each patient. By combining active ingredients, pharmacists can create compounds that address diverse medical conditions. This personalized approach allows for dosages precisely measured to his or her individual needs, potentially improving treatment outcomes.
Compound pharmacies also offer specialized mixtures for patients who have difficulty swallowing pills, experience allergies to common ingredients, or require medications in specific forms like gels, creams, or suppositories. This adaptability makes compound pharmacies a vital option for patients seeking innovative treatment solutions.
The Power of Active Pharmaceutical Ingredients in Drug Development
Active pharmaceutical ingredients elements (APIs) are the fundamental building blocks of drug development. These potent molecules possess the capacity to exert a therapeutic effect on the human body. A successful drug's efficacy relies heavily on the selection and optimization of its API. The creation of novel APIs is a complex and demanding process that requires expertise in medicinal chemistry, pharmacology, and toxicology.
Research and development efforts focus on identifying promising API candidates that exhibit high potency, selectivity, and safety. Once a promising API is identified, extensive preclinical and clinical trials are performed to evaluate its safety, efficacy, and pharmacokinetic properties. The ultimate goal of API development is to create safe and effective medications that promote patient health and well-being.
Understanding the Role of Compounding Pharmacies in Modern Healthcare
In today's dynamic healthcare landscape, compounding pharmacies play a essential role in offering personalized medication solutions. These specialized pharmacies manufacture customized medications to meet the unique needs of patients who may not find suitable options through traditional drugstore channels. Compounding pharmacists employ their expertise and abilities to develop medications in various forms, including creams, gels, liquids, and suppositories. This flexibility allows them to adjust to individual patient requirements, such as allergies, sensitivities, or difficulty swallowing pills.
Moreover, compounding pharmacies contribute in managing complex medical conditions by providing custom medications that are not readily available through standard get more info pharmaceutical channels. This is particularly important for patients with rare diseases or those who require alternative treatment options. Furthermore, compounding pharmacies often collaborate with healthcare professionals to create personalized medication regimens that are adjusted for individual patient needs. By connecting the gap between traditional medicine and individualized care, compounding pharmacies contribute in improving patient outcomes and overall health.

Active Pharmaceutical Ingredients: The Building Blocks of Medication
Pharmaceutical medications are complex formulations designed to manage a variety of ailments. At the heart of these preparations lie active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s), the crucial components responsible for producing the desired pharmacological effect. APIs are molecules that interact with specific targets in the body to influence biological processes and alleviate symptoms. From pain relievers to antibiotics, APIs form the foundation of modern medicine, driving innovation and providing effective treatments for a wide range of health challenges.
